About MHA - Home Team Academy (HTA)
As the Corporate University of the Home Team, the Home Team Academy (HTA) plays a crucial role in the Home Team training and learning ecosystem to develop skilled and future-oriented HT leaders and officers. HTA focuses on empowering learning and growth in order to enable a united and successful Home Team. This includes leadership development, trainer development, skills transformation, continuous education and training, Home Team integration, and training safety.In transforming into a digitally empowered and future-ready Corporate University of the Home Team, HTA aims to achieve our mission by supporting Training and Learning with Technology & Digitalisation and Partnerships, with People at our heart.
